Does Condo Insurance Cover Water Damage?

Does condo insurance cover water damage

Condo insurance may cover water damage, but it depends on the cause of the loss and the details of the policy. In many cases, coverage is more likely when the damage comes from a sudden and accidental event, such as a burst pipe or overflowing appliance. Coverage is often less likely when the issue developed slowly over time or resulted from lack of maintenance.

In a condo, there is another layer to consider. There may be a master policy for the building and an individual policy for the unit owner. One may apply to parts of the structure, while the other may apply to interior finishes, personal property, or loss of use. Responsibility can also change depending on where the water started and which areas were affected.

That is why the first steps matter. Stop the source if possible, document the damage, notify building management, review the master policy and your own policy, and report the claim quickly. It also helps to ask who is responsible for drywall, flooring, cabinets, and shared building systems.

Even when coverage exists, waiting too long can make the claim harder. Fast mitigation shows that reasonable steps were taken to prevent further damage.
